# Introduction

To perform **any action** (such as moving, resizing, or deleting) on page elements, you must **first select them**.\
Sometimes elements are **automatically selected** (for example, right after creation), but in other cases, **manual selection** is required.

When a page element is selected, it will show **eight grab handles** — one at each corner and one at the middle of each side.
